Bradley Thomas Casey, 27, of McLeansville, passed away Thursday, February 1, 2024 at his home. Services to celebrate his life will be at 1 PM, Saturday, February 10, 2024 at Crusade Baptist Church, 2919 Huffine Mill Road, Gibsonville, NC, officiated by Pastor Michael R. Martin. The family will receive friends from 11 AM to 1 PM prior to the service at the church and interment will be in Lakeview Memorial Park. The family will receive friends at other times at his grandparent’s home of Billy Roberts.
Bradley was born in Greensboro to Clifton Faircloth and Kimberly Akers and graduated from Vandalia Christian School in 2015. He was a hard-working and dedicated employee for over eight years with Proctor & Gamble as a plant technician. Bradley was an outdoorsman who enjoyed hunting, fishing and target practice. He will be remembered as a jokester with a great sense of humor and a dedicated friend and family man. Bradley was an old soul who enjoyed traditional country music, playing video games, and going out to eat. His family is comforted that his salvation was secure in the Lord.
Bradley is survived by his mother and step-father, Kimberly and Michael Akers of McLeansville; father, Clifton Faircloth, Jr. of Greensboro, sister and brother-in-law, Jessica and Luis Caban of TX and maternal grandfather, Billy Thomas Roberts. Also surviving are nieces and nephews, Kailyn and Kylie Roberts, Drake Gonzalez, Alyssa and Christian Caban and Abigail and extended family including aunts, uncles and cousins. He was preceded in death by his grandmothers, Nadine Roberts and Glenda Dixon and grandfathers, Tom Dixon and Clifton Lacy Faircloth, Sr.
